If your appetite for all things itchy and tasty is as bottomless as mine, you may want to get some bite-sized (forgive the pun) zombie action with Block Zombies, an indie game that’s out now on Xbox Live.

I’ve noticed a lot of my friends having issues finding the indie section of the games marketplace — the craptacular new dashboard is definitely to blame here — so here are the steps that ought to take you right to it. First, jump into the Games Marketplace, then trot on over to the Games tab, and select Game Type — it’s that button with the chick who’s jumping for some reason. Maybe she’s just really excited to be introducing you to arcade games? Once there you can select Indie Games, and Voila! You’re there. head past the break for the game’s synopsis and a few screenshots. Here’s the synopsis for Dead Block, out now for the cheap price of 80 Microsoft Scooper Poopers, or one dollar.

In a world gone wrong, one girl stands alone. Alone, but not unarmed!

Strange crystalline structures have turned the populace into mindless, zombie-like creatures.

Explore a variety of environments and upgrade your arsenal as you take on the zombies and blow them into their constituent blocky bits.

Fight the Zombies! Stop the Infection! Save the Day!

We have the Jason Universe to thank for the recent return of Jason Voorhees, with the short film Sweet Revenge and Jason’s arrival in Dead by Daylight helping to bring the hockey mask-wearing horror icon back into our lives. What else is planned, you ask?

In a chat with Variety this week, Jason Universe’s Robbie Barsamian teases that everything we’ve seen up to this point is just the tip of the iceberg when it comes to Jason’s return.

“We’ve been busy behind the scenes laying the foundation that everyone is finally starting to see come to life, but this is just the tip of the iceberg,” Barsamian teases.

“We have a thrilling lineup of new projects that we can’t wait to share more details on soon.”

Barsamian also notes during the chat with Variety, “We want to give fans fresh takes on what they love most about Jason and continue to expand his world in authentic ways that resonate with horror fans today.” One of those expansions will take the form of the upcoming Peacock and A24 series “Crystal Lake,” which stars Linda Cardellini as Pamela Voorhees.

“The Crystal Lake TV series will take fans back in time to tell the story of how Pamela Voorhees came to be the mother of all slashers,” Barsamian tells Variety this week.

“Crystal Lake” premieres October 15 on Peacock.

Callum Vinson (“Chucky”) is playing young Jason in “Crystal Lake,” which will tell the origin story of the masked slasher who has stalked the grounds of Crystal Lake for decades.

Last year, the Jason Universe team had teased that a new movie and a new video game are top priorities for the near future. But at this time we have no updates on either front.
